About the Role
We are currently seeking qualified and experienced Sprinkler Fitters to join our team in a full-time, on-site role. You will be responsible for the installation, maintenance, testing, and repair of fire sprinkler systems and associated fire protection infrastructure. You’ll work both independently and as part of a team to deliver high-quality service and ensure compliance with Australian Standards and relevant codes.
We are also open to licensed plumbers with fire protection experience who are interested in expanding their career into sprinkler fitting. Comprehensive training and support will be provided to help the right candidate transition into this specialised trade.
What You’ll Be Working On
You will be supported with training and ongoing development and will work with systems such as:
Fire Sprinkler Systems – wet, dry, pre-action, and deluge systems
Fire Hydrants and Hose Reels
Fire Pumps and Pump Sets
Flow Testing and Commissioning of Sprinkler Installations
Minor Pipework Modifications and Rectification Work
